Abstract

To solve a problem that there is a need to use a long, large scale, expensive, and strong material if a stopper member for preventing vibration such as an earthquake is provided in a case where a vibration isolating apparatus is attached between a conventional hanging cradle and air conditioning device.SOLUTION: A hanging cradle comprises: a hanging cradle main body 12; a vibration isolating apparatus 103 whose upper part is connected to a lower part of the hanging cradle main body 12; a swing stopping frame member 1 attached to the lower part of the hanging cradle main body 12; and a stopper member 2 fixed to a prescribed position of the swing stopping frame member 1. An upper part of an object apparatus 101 is connected to a lower part of the vibration isolating apparatus 103. In a state where the object apparatus 101 is hung by the vibration isolating apparatus 103, the swing stopping frame member 1 as a countermeasure for earthquake resistant reinforcement is disposed to be separated from the vibration isolating apparatus 103, and the stopper member 2 is disposed at a position so as to face the object apparatus 101 with a prescribed interval in a horizontal direction.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 3

本発明は、たとえば、建物の天井から空調機器などを吊下げて設置するために利用する吊下げ架台に関する。 B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to, for example, a hanging frame used for hanging and installing an air conditioner or the like from the ceiling of a building.

例えば図7、図8に示すように、建物の天井100に空調機器101などを吊り下げるための吊下げ架台102が知られている。 For example, as shown in FIGS. 7 and 8, a suspension frame 102 for suspending an air conditioner 101 or the like from a ceiling 100 of a building is known.

ここに、103は地震などの振動対策のために設けた防振器具であって、吊下げ架台102と空調機器101との間に配置され、その上端103aは吊下げ架台102の下面102aに連結されるとともに、その下端103bは空調機器101の上面101aの空調機器の吊下げ用金具101bに連結されている。 Here, reference numeral 103 denotes a vibration isolator provided as a countermeasure against vibrations such as earthquakes, which is arranged between the suspension frame 102 and the air conditioner 101, and its upper end 103a is connected to the lower surface 102a of the suspension frame 102. The lower end 103b of the air conditioner 101 is connected to the hanging metal fitting 101b of the air conditioner 101 on the upper surface 101a of the air conditioner 101 .

ところで、地震が発生したときに生じる、空調機器101への水平方向の振れを抑制するために、吊下げ架台102の下面102aからストッパー部材104を下方に伸ばし、その下端104aで空調機器101の横揺れを抑制することがある。 By the way, in order to suppress the horizontal vibration of the air conditioner 101 that occurs when an earthquake occurs, the stopper member 104 extends downward from the lower surface 102a of the suspension frame 102, and the lower end 104a of the stopper member 104 extends laterally of the air conditioner 101. It can suppress shaking.

しかしながら、そのようなやり方では、空調機器101と吊下げ架台102との離隔距離が長くなるため、ストッパー部材104の長さも大きくならざるを得ない。すなわち耐震補強対策のための振れ止め対策が大掛かりとなり、高価で丈夫な材料を使う必要があるという課題があった。 However, in such a method, the separation distance between the air conditioner 101 and the suspension frame 102 becomes long, so the length of the stopper member 104 also becomes large. In other words, there was a problem that the anti-vibration countermeasure for seismic reinforcement measures was large-scale, and it was necessary to use expensive and strong materials.

本発明は、上述された従来の課題を考慮し、耐震補強対策の振れ止め対策がコンパクトとなり、コストも安価な吊下げ架台を提供することを目的とする。 S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ION In consideration of the conventional problems described above, it is an object of the present invention to provide a suspension mount that is compact in anti-vibration measures for seismic reinforcement and is inexpensive in cost.

図面を参照しながら、本発明における実施の形態について詳細に説明する。 Emb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ings.

図1は本発明の実施の形態にかかる吊下げ架台の例を示す正面図、図2はその略示側断面図、図3、図4、図5、図6はいろいろな角度から見た斜視図である。 FIG. 1 is a front view showing an example of a hanging stand according to an embodiment of the present invention, FIG. 2 is a schematic side sectional view thereof, and FIGS. 3, 4, 5 and 6 are perspective views seen from various angles. It is a diagram.

吊下げ架台の本体12は、建物の天井100からほぼ直方体形状の空調機器101を吊り下げている。ここに、103は防振対策のために設けた防振器具であって、吊下げ架台の本体12と空調機器101との間に配置され、その上端103aは吊下げ架台の本体12の下部12aに連結されるとともに、その下端103bは空調機器101の上面101aの空調機器の吊下げ用金具101bに連結されている。 A main body 12 of the suspension frame suspends a substantially rectangular parallelepiped air conditioner 101 from the ceiling 100 of the building. Here, reference numeral 103 is a vibration isolator provided for anti-vibration measures. , and the lower end 103b thereof is connected to the hanging metal fitting 101b of the air conditioner 101 on the upper surface 101a of the air conditioner 101. As shown in FIG.

さらに、1は、耐震補強対策の振れ止め用フレーム部材(以下単に振れ止め用フレーム部材という)であって、吊下げ架台の本体12の下部12aに固定されている。その形状は略矩形上の下面フレーム1bと、それぞれの角部に立設した4本の縦フレーム1aと、中間に立設した2本の縦フレーム1cで構成されている。その4本の縦フレーム1a,1a,1a,1aと、2本の縦フレーム1cはそれぞれ吊下げ架台の本体12の下部12aに固定されている。 Furthermore, reference numeral 1 denotes a frame member for anti-seismic reinforcement (hereinafter simply referred to as a frame member for anti-vibration), which is fixed to the lower portion 12a of the main body 12 of the hanging frame. Its shape is composed of a substantially rectangular lower frame 1b, four vertical frames 1a erected at each corner, and two vertical frames 1c erected in the middle. The four vertical frames 1a, 1a, 1a, 1a and the two vertical frames 1c are fixed to the lower part 12a of the main body 12 of the hanging frame.

他方、下面フレーム1bは吊下げ対象とする空調機器101の略矩形上の上面101aの各辺に沿ったフレーム形状をしている。ただし、下面フレーム1bを構成する4本の辺フレーム1b1,1b2,1b3,1b4の内で、対向する一対のフレームは、上記空調機器101の上面101aの各辺より内側へ配置されるようになっている。 On the other hand, the lower surface frame 1b has a frame shape along each side of the substantially rectangular upper surface 101a of the air conditioner 101 to be suspended. However, of the four side frames 1b1, 1b2, 1b3, and 1b4 that constitute the lower frame 1b, a pair of opposing frames are arranged inside each side of the upper surface 101a of the air conditioner 101. ing.

図示実施例では、辺フレーム1b1と1b3が内側へ配置され、辺フレーム1b2と1b4はわずかに外側へ配置されている。このような構成によって、地震による縦揺れに対しても、この内側に寄っている辺フレーム1b1,1b3が空調機器101の上面に当たることによってストッパーの役割を果たすことが出来るメリットがある。なお、4つの辺フレームが全て内側に配置されていてもかまわない。このように、振れ止め用フレーム部材1は吊下げ架台の本体12と同じ程度の骨格(特に水平方向において)を有することになる。 In the illustrated embodiment, side frames 1b1 and 1b3 are positioned inwards and side frames 1b2 and 1b4 are positioned slightly outwards. With such a configuration, there is an advantage that the inward side frames 1b1 and 1b3 come into contact with the upper surface of the air conditioner 101 and play a role of a stopper against pitching caused by an earthquake. Note that all four side frames may be arranged inside. In this way, the steady rest frame member 1 has the same degree of skeleton (especially in the horizontal direction) as the main body 12 of the suspension cradle.

なお、本実施例では防振器具103は、この振れ止め用フレーム部材1の下面フレーム1bより外側に配置されている。 In this embodiment, the anti-vibration device 103 is arranged outside the lower surface frame 1b of the anti-vibration frame member 1. As shown in FIG.

さらに、振れ止め用フレーム部材1の所定箇所にストッパー部材2が取り付けられている。すなわち、図3(A)、図3(B)に示すように、本実施例では辺フレーム1b1と辺フレーム1b3にそれぞれ2個のストッパー部材2が所定の間隔を置いて取り付けられている。図3(B)は一部拡大略示断面拡大図である。辺フレーム1b1と辺フレーム1b3はL字状フレームであって、その縦部1b1bが横部1b1aより内側に来るように取り付けられている。そして、L字状のストッパー部材2はその横部2bが縦部2aより内側に来るように配置され、その横部2bと、辺フレーム1b1,1b3の横部1b1aとが内側同士重なり合わされ2本のボルトで互いに固定されることによって、ストッパー部材2が辺フレーム1b1,1b3に取り付けられている。 Further, a stopper member 2 is attached to a predetermined portion of the frame member 1 for anti-vibration. That is, as shown in FIGS. 3(A) and 3(B), in this embodiment, two stopper members 2 are attached to each of the side frame 1b1 and the side frame 1b3 at a predetermined interval. FIG. 3B is a partially enlarged schematic sectional enlarged view. The side frame 1b1 and the side frame 1b3 are L-shaped frames, and are attached so that the vertical portion 1b1b is located inside the horizontal portion 1b1a. The L-shaped stopper member 2 is arranged such that the horizontal portion 2b is located inside the vertical portion 2a, and the horizontal portion 2b and the horizontal portions 1b1a of the side frames 1b1 and 1b3 are overlapped with each other to form two pieces. The stopper member 2 is attached to the side frames 1b1 and 1b3 by being fixed to each other with bolts.

さらに、そのストッパー部材2の縦部2aの内側は、上記吊下げられた状態において、空調機器101の上面101aの各辺から水平方向に所定の間隔をもって対向した位置に配置されている。防振器具103の機能を損なわない範囲で余裕を持たすためである。そして大きな横揺れが発生したときには当接させることでストッパー機能を発揮する。その結果、空調機器101が水平方向に横揺れすることで機器吊りボルトの破断による空調機器の脱落や、空調機器に接続されている配管等の損傷による機能停止を防ぐことができる。 Further, the inner side of the vertical portion 2a of the stopper member 2 is arranged at a position opposed to each side of the upper surface 101a of the air conditioner 101 in the suspended state with a predetermined gap in the horizontal direction. This is to provide a margin within a range that does not impair the function of the anti-vibration device 103 . And when a large horizontal shake occurs, it exerts a stopper function by contacting it. As a result, the air conditioning equipment 101 can be prevented from falling off due to breakage of the equipment hanging bolts due to the horizontal rocking of the air conditioning equipment 101, and from stopping functioning due to damage to pipes or the like connected to the air conditioning equipment.

他方、辺フレーム1b2,1b4は、辺フレーム1b1,1b3と同様にL字状フレームであるが、図3(A)、図3(C)に示すように、その縦部1b2bが横部1b2aより外側に来るように取り付けられている。図3(C)は一部拡大略示断面図である。そして、こちらのL字状のストッパー部材3はその横部3bが縦部3aより外側に来るように配置され、その横部3bと、辺フレーム1b2,1b4の横部1b2aとが外側同士重なり合わされ2本のボルトで互いに固定されることによって、ストッパー部材3が辺フレーム1b2,1b4に取り付けられている。 On the other hand, the side frames 1b2 and 1b4 are L-shaped frames like the side frames 1b1 and 1b3, but as shown in FIGS. It is installed so that it comes to the outside. FIG. 3(C) is a partially enlarged schematic sectional view. The L-shaped stopper member 3 is arranged so that the horizontal portion 3b is located outside the vertical portion 3a, and the horizontal portion 3b and the horizontal portions 1b2a of the side frames 1b2 and 1b4 are overlapped with each other. The stopper member 3 is attached to the side frames 1b2 and 1b4 by being mutually fixed with two bolts.

さらに、そのストッパー部材3の縦部3aの外側は、上記吊下げられた状態において、空調機器101の上面101aの各辺から水平方向に所定の間隔をもって対向した位置に配置されている。上述したように防振器具103の機能を損なわない範囲で余裕を持たすためである。そして大きな横揺れが発生したときには当接させることでストッパー機能を発揮する。 Further, the outer side of the vertical portion 3a of the stopper member 3 is arranged at a position opposed to each side of the upper surface 101a of the air conditioner 101 in the suspended state with a predetermined gap in the horizontal direction. This is to provide a margin within a range that does not impair the function of the anti-vibration device 103 as described above. And when a large horizontal shake occurs, it exerts a stopper function by contacting it.

なお、ストッパー部材2,3は、吊下げる対象となる空調機器101などの上面形状が様々なので、あまり横幅を長く出来ない特徴がある。本実施例の場合、ストッパー部材2,3を吊下げ架台の本体12に直接取り付けるのではなく、吊下げ架台の本体12と同じ程度の骨格(特に水平方向において)を有する振れ止め用フレーム部材1の下部に取り付けているので、従来のようにかなり縦長の部材にすることなく、振れを規制できる長所がある。 It should be noted that the stopper members 2 and 3 are characterized in that the horizontal width of the stopper members 2 and 3 cannot be made very long because the shape of the upper surface of the air conditioner 101 or the like to be hung varies. In the case of this embodiment, instead of directly attaching the stopper members 2 and 3 to the main body 12 of the suspension frame, the anti-vibration frame member 1 having the same skeleton (especially in the horizontal direction) as the main body 12 of the suspension frame. Since it is attached to the lower part of the , there is an advantage that it can control the vibration without making it a vertically long member like the conventional one.

なお、本発明の振れ止め用フレーム部材の下部は対象機器の上部の外周に沿った形状であれば、矩形に限らず円形などであってもかまわない。 The lower part of the anti-vibration frame member of the present invention is not limited to a rectangular shape, and may be circular as long as it follows the outer periphery of the upper part of the target device.

また、本発明のストッパー部材は個数に制限は特にないが、地震の振れは左右いづれからも生じる可能性があるので、少なくとも4方向に少なくとも一個配置されることが望ましいが、これに限らない。 Also, the number of stopper members of the present invention is not particularly limited, but it is desirable that at least one stopper member be arranged in at least four directions because the shaking of an earthquake may occur from either the left or the right, but the present invention is not limited to this.

本発明における吊下げ架台は、本発明は、地震などの揺れ対策としてのストッパー部材がコンパクトとなり、コストも安価になるので、空調機器などを吊り下げる吊下げ架台などに有用である。 The suspension frame according to the present invention is useful as a suspension frame for suspending air conditioners, etc., because the stopper member of the present invention is compact as a countermeasure against vibrations such as earthquakes, and the cost is low.
